Inside a Quantum Computer! with Andrea Morello (Part 1 of 2)
An in-depth look at the engineering inside a quantum computer, and also demonstrating the operational results live and how they are measured.
With Professor Andrea Morello who is the Scientia Professor of quantum engineering in the School of Electrical Engineering and Telecommunications at the University of New South Wales, and a Program Manager at the ARC Centre of Excellence for Quantum Computation and Communication Technology.
